2000 Opel Corsa vs. 1999 Suzuki Swift
To start off, 2000 Opel Corsa is newer by 1 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1999 Suzuki Swift.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1999 Suzuki Swift would be higher. At 1,389 cc (4 cylinders), 2000 Opel Corsa is equipped with a bigger engine.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2000 Opel Corsa (104 Nm @ 3000 RPM) has 28 more torque (in Nm) than 1999 Suzuki Swift. (76 Nm @ 3300 RPM). This means 2000 Opel Corsa will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1999 Suzuki Swift.
